| Who | What they could actually see | What they concluded | Verdict |
|---|---|---|---|
| EU region | Writes accepted locally; replication queue to US growing. | The US region is down. Continue serving; we will catch up. | ✕ wrong |
| US region | The mirror image: writes accepted locally, replication queue to EU growing. | The EU region is down. | ✕ wrong |
| Support agent in Dublin | A customer’s record with the address they had just corrected. | The correction is saved and globally visible. | ✕ wrong |
| Conflict resolver (last-write-wins on wall clock) | Two versions of the same record with timestamps 900ms apart. | The later timestamp is the newer edit; keep it. | ✕ wrong |
4 of 4 parties reasoned correctly from what they could see and still reached the wrong conclusion. Nobody in this table is careless. Each one acted on complete-looking local information, and the information was local. That gap — between what a node can observe and what is true — is the whole domain, and one of these readings will usually be yours.
